Adopt Lovcia

Mixed Breed · Unknown · Puppy · 2 months

She came to us on September 29, 2024 from Św. Kamila Street at the age of about two months. She was sick then and needed veterinary care. After her illness, there is almost no trace left. It's time to look for a new loving family for life. Although Lovcia has not really known people well so far, she is becoming more and more convinced of us. She would definitely get along with another kitten. Like any kitten, she likes to play, run and jump; sometimes it's hard to keep up with her. She uses the litter box. She has been vaccinated, dewormed and microchipped. In the future, you should contact us to have a free spaying procedure done.

🇵🇱Adopting from Poland

Polish shelters maintain established transport routes to Germany, Netherlands, Austria, and Sweden. Animals leave sterilized and chipped. Adoption fees are typically lower than in Western Europe (often €50–€150) but adopters cover transport.

Can I adopt Lovcia if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— Schronisko Zabrze will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
